There is the perception that European makes suffer more "electronic" problems (like ABS, SRS, Check Engine warning lights coming on a lot more frequent than Jap makes). I guess that's true to a certain extent in relation to Audis, BMWs and Mercedes.
But I'm glad to say that, speaking from experience as an owner of a 9000CS (MY95) since 1995, Saabs (at least those dating from the mid-1990s) are electronically reliable. Yes, I've replaced the SRS ECU, but that's because it was physically wrecked by coolant from a leaking heater core. And although one of the front wheel's ABS sensor was replaced, it was again due to physical damage: sensor cable severed due to frequent twisting when front wheels turn left or right.
